Brightside's Holman: departure is amicable

Martyn Holman

Martyn Holman has described his upcoming departure from Brightside Group as an amicable split.

Holman stated that his decision to leave the role of Brightside chief executive pre-dated the failure of the takeover bid by Markerstudy in September 2013.

He said: “I have been considering it for some while. Having been here since we set the business up seven years ago, it’s probably time for a change.”

Referring to his resignation, Holman said it was simply "fate of timing" that meant he was leaving so soon after the Markerstudy deal fell through.
